The Specialty Pharmacy Navigator assists in performing manipulative and non-discretionary functions associated with the practice of pharmacy under the supervision of a licensed pharmacist to include receiving orders via telephone, fax, and printers and directly from customers. Performs phone call follow ups with patients, providers and pharmacy staff regarding medication orders and claim status. Acts as a support system, providing guidance and education to patients and their families. This is a staff level position working under supervision of a pharmacist. Work situations are a variety of routine duties and functions that require organization and attention to detail.
MultiCare Tacoma General Hospital, in the heart of Tacoma, WA, is a 367-bed regional medical center delivering cutting-edge care. With a 24-hour Emergency Department, Level II Adult Trauma Center, advanced cardiac, neurological, orthopedic and robotic surgery, Tacoma General combines innovation with compassionate care. Home to the MultiCare Regional Cancer Center, a Family Birth Center and specialized neonatal care in partnership with Mary Bridge Children's, our collaborative, mission-driven teams offer a rewarding environment for career growth and professional excellence.
